The opportunity

Birchwell Associates is supporting a growing technology business in the search for a Full-Stack Developer. This role will suit an engineer who enjoys working across the full product stack and taking ownership of features from initial design through to production.

You will collaborate with product, UX, frontend, backend and DevOps colleagues to build new SaaS capabilities, improve existing services and help maintain a clean, scalable and dependable engineering platform.

What you will be doing

  • Build responsive product features using React and TypeScript.
  • Design and develop backend services and REST APIs using Node.js or Python.
  • Work with relational databases and data models to support new product capabilities.
  • Deliver features through testing, code review, deployment and production support.
  • Improve application performance, reliability, accessibility and security across the stack.
  • Contribute to engineering standards, reusable components, documentation and technical decision-making.

What we are looking for

  • Commercial experience building and supporting full-stack web applications.
  • Strong JavaScript or TypeScript skills with experience using React.
  • Backend development experience with Node.js, Python or a comparable modern framework.
  • Experience designing and integrating APIs and working with relational databases.
  • Familiarity with automated testing, Git workflows, cloud platforms and CI/CD delivery.
  • Clear communication, strong problem-solving skills and confidence working in a collaborative product team.

What is on offer

  • Salary between £55,000 and £70,000, depending on experience.
  • Hybrid working from Manchester.
  • Ownership of complete product features across frontend and backend systems.
  • Modern React, TypeScript, API and cloud tooling.
  • A collaborative engineering environment with scope to develop toward senior engineering or technical leadership.
